CI workflows on Tangled for Elixir
https://tangled.org is a Github competitor built on top of atproto, the same protocol that Bluesky runs on. With their new microvm workflow engine you can run Elixir CI jobs with a PostgreSQL service, but it took some figuring out so I’m sharing an example and some notes here!
